OrganizationFour Seasons Hotels & ResortsJob DescriptionWhat You’ll Be Doing: Initiatives (70%) - Manage cross-functional strategic initiatives (i.e., Design Standards, Sustainability, Consultant Library, etc.), from development through to successful execution. - Coordinate inquiries, develop action plans, and assist with preparation and dissemination of communications to clearly relay ideas. - Support teams with decision-making, program management, and other initiative planning or implementation activities. - Undertake special projects as required per direction of SVP, Design Services. Project Support (30%) - Provide project support to VPs and Regional Project Leads. - Assist Project Leads in coordinating with internal stakeholders. - Support preparation of project area programs (Area Summary). - Assemble, with guidance of Project Lead, Recommended Consultant List. - Coordinate design review from concept through construction document phases to ensure compliance with Four Seasons Design Standards. - Review shop drawings and material samples and all relevant key project documentation. - Manage project updates and contribute to internal reports. - Participate and contribute to development and maintenance of various brand standard documents. - Travel as required based on project status. - Other job-related duties as requested. What You Bring: - Licensed/Regulated Professional status beneficial (i.e., Licensed Architect, P. Eng., etc). - LEED accreditation preferred. - Bachelor’s Degree in Architecture, Interior Design, Engineering, or a related field required. - Master’s Degree in Business or related field beneficial. - Minimum 5 years post-graduate project experience. - Ideal candidate will have knowledge and experience in hospitality design. - Luxury hospitality operator experience preferred. - Strong knowledge of construction and design process within the luxury segment of hospitality. - Ability to coordinate and cross-reference design drawings from multiple disciplines. - Solid understanding of hotel planning principles. - Advanced understanding of Microsoft PowerPoint, Excel, and Word to develop Executive-level presentations and working documents. - Advanced design software skills including CAD/other drafting software, Bluebeam, and Adobe Creative Suite. - Fluent with design and construction industry terminology and practices. Key Skills/Who You Are: - High degree of interpersonal skills to deal effectively with all business contacts. - Productive self-starter, with excellent critical thinking ability and capable of working with limited supervision. - Ability to work effectively and handle several projects/deadlines. - Great team player, but able to work independently with some degree of ambiguity. - Possess creative problem-solving and technical skills including a good grasp of design and construction principles. - Excellent communication skills to convey concepts in a clear and understandable fashion. Ability to effectively communicate in English, in both oral and written forms. - Disciplined adherence to schedules and consistent performance on deliverables. - Good documentation and customer service skills.
